Is your bake element getting hot? ( preheat uses broil and bake elements, baking uses just the bake element. ) You could have a bad temperature sensor or a bad computer or maybe this computer has an adjustment off-set for temperature.

I recently purchased a used JDS1750 FS Range. Since having it installed, we've tried using the oven a few times and find that the oven gets stuck in preheat mode, about 30-75 degrees below where it should be.

The oven itself has no problem reaching our desired temps, however, we have to go above what we are wanting to set it to in order to achieve that.

IE: if i want it set to 350f, it only gets to about 300, but if I set it to 425F, i can get it to 350F but it still remains in "pre-heating" mode as per the display on the screen.

Any ideas on what this could be?
